Classic Father’s Day Lunch Recipes
Some dads love the comfort of traditional, hearty meals. These classic recipes never go out of style and are sure to satisfy.
1. Steak and Mashed Potatoes
A juicy steak served with creamy mashed potatoes is a go-to favorite.
2. Cheeseburgers with All the Fixings
Grill or pan-fry burgers and let everyone build their own with lettuce, cheese, tomato, and sauces.
3. Chicken Alfredo Pasta
Creamy, rich, and full of flavor—this pasta dish is great for indoor family lunches.

Grilling Ideas for the Perfect Father’s Day BBQ
If your dad loves being outdoors, a backyard BBQ is a fun and tasty way to celebrate.
1. BBQ Ribs
Smoky and tender, these ribs are always a hit with BBQ lovers.
2. Grilled Chicken Kabobs
Easy to make and fun to eat—add peppers, onions, and pineapple for flavor and color.
3. Veggie Skewers
For dads who like a lighter bite, grilled veggies are a healthy and tasty option.

Quick and Easy Lunch Options for Busy Families
Don’t have much time? No worries! These quick lunch recipes are delicious and stress-free.
1. Turkey Sandwich Wraps
Use tortillas, sliced turkey, cheese, and lettuce for a simple wrap that travels well too.
2. Tuna Pasta Salad
Cold pasta with tuna, mayo, and veggies is refreshing and filling.
3. Egg Fried Rice
Use leftover rice and eggs with a splash of soy sauce for a fast and flavorful dish.

Healthy Lunch Alternatives for Health-Conscious Dads
Some dads are health-focused and appreciate meals that are both tasty and good for the body.
1. Grilled Salmon with Quinoa
Light and full of protein, this dish is great for dads who love clean eating.
2. Greek Salad with Grilled Chicken
Fresh veggies, olives, and feta cheese paired with lean chicken is a winning combo.
3. Lentil Soup with Whole Wheat Bread
Nutritious and comforting, lentil soup is rich in fiber and flavor.

Unique International Recipes to Surprise Dad
Want to try something new? Explore flavors from around the world that might become Dad’s new favorite.
1. Mexican Tacos
Fill soft or hard taco shells with beef, chicken, beans, or veggies.
2. Indian Butter Chicken with Rice
Creamy, mildly spicy butter chicken is packed with flavor and goes perfectly with rice or naan.
3. Japanese Teriyaki Chicken
Sweet and savory teriyaki glaze makes chicken shine—serve with steamed rice and veggies.

Pairing Drinks with Father’s Day Lunch
A good drink completes the meal! Choose beverages that match the lunch and Dad’s taste.
1. Fresh Lemonade or Iced Tea
Great with BBQ or sandwiches—cool and refreshing.
2. Sparkling Water with Lime
A healthy option that feels fancy.
3. Craft Beer or Cider
If your dad enjoys a chilled brew, pick his favorite to pair with grilled or hearty dishes.

Tips for Setting the Perfect Father’s Day Table
A nicely decorated table makes any meal feel like a celebration, even a simple lunch.
1. Use Dad’s Favorite Colors
Decorate with tablecloths, napkins, or dishes in colors Dad loves.
2. Add Personal Touches
Write little thank-you notes or place photos around the table.
3. Keep It Casual but Special
An outdoor picnic or a backyard table with flowers and candles adds charm without stress.

FAQs About Father’s Day Lunch Ideas
What are some quick Father’s Day lunch ideas?
Quick options include turkey wraps, egg fried rice, and tuna pasta salad. They’re easy to make and still taste great.
What can I cook for my dad if he’s a health-conscious eater?
Try grilled salmon with quinoa, Greek salad with chicken, or a veggie-loaded lentil soup.
Can kids help prepare Father’s Day lunch?
Yes! Kids can help by mixing ingredients, setting the table, or making simple dishes like sandwiches or fruit salad.
What drink pairs well with a BBQ lunch?
Try lemonade, iced tea, or a cold craft beer if your dad drinks alcohol. For a healthy choice, offer sparkling water with fruit.
How can I decorate the lunch table for Father’s Day?
Use Dad’s favorite colors, write short thank-you notes, and add small decorations like candles or family photos.
